Introduction

Christopher C. Briggs is an accomplished inventor based in Chandler, AZ (US). He is known for his significant contributions to the field of noninvasive medical measurements. His innovative work focuses on improving the accuracy of blood and tissue analyte measurements through advanced error detection systems.

Latest Patents

Briggs holds a patent for an "Intelligent system for detecting errors and determining failure modes in noninvasive measurement of blood and tissue analytes." This intelligent system operates on the absorbance spectrum of in vivo skin tissue. The application of this system results in improved prediction accuracy by rejecting invalid and poor samples. The system includes a noninvasive blood glucose meter, such as a near-infrared spectrometer, an error detection system (EDS), a method for diagnosing and mitigating errors, and a reporting method. The EDS employs a pattern classification engine and a hierarchy of levels to analyze, detect, and diagnose instrument, interface, and sample errors. This process determines the suitability of an absorbance spectrum for blood glucose measurement. The final component evaluates the error condition, diagnoses the specific mode of failure if necessary, and reports the actions to be taken. The sub-components and levels of the EDS can operate independently, enhancing the functionality of the noninvasive glucose measurement system.
